小编Par*_*hit的帖子

连接urllib2后如何确定服务器的IP地址?

我正在使用urllib2从服务器下载数据.但我需要确定我连接的服务器的IP地址.

import urllib2
STD_HEADERS = {'Accept': 'text/html,application/xhtml+xml,application/xml;q=0.9,
                    */*;q=0.8',
                'Accept-Charset': 'ISO-8859-1,utf-8;q=0.7,*;q=0.7',
                'Accept-Language': 'en-us,en;q=0.5',
                'User-Agent': 'Mozilla/5.0 (X11; U; Linux x86_64;en-US;rv:1.9.2.12)     
                           Gecko/20101028 Firefox/3.6.12'}
request = urllib2.Request(url, None, STD_HEADERS)
data =  urllib2.urlopen(request)
Run Code Online (Sandbox Code Playgroud)

请不要让我使用URL找到IP地址,因为这不能保证从中下载数据的服务器和IP地址查询在"HTTPRedirects"或负载均衡服务器的情况下解析为相同的IP地址

python ip-address urllib2

3
推荐指数
1
解决办法
6141
查看次数

在Python中将元组字符串转换为元组列表

如何转换"[(5, 2), (1,3), (4,5)]"为元组列表 [(5, 2), (1,3), (4,5)]

我使用的planetlab是不支持的shell "import ast".所以我无法使用它.

python

2
推荐指数
1
解决办法
3093
查看次数

使用Python将Excel中的图表导出为图像

我一直在尝试将Excel中的图表导出为Python中的图像文件(JPG或ING).我在看WIn32com.这就是我现在所拥有的.

import win32com.client as win32
excel = win32.gencache.EnsureDispatch("Excel.Application")
wb = excel.Workbooks.Open("<WORKSHEET NAME>")
r = wb.Sheets("<SHEET NAME>").Range("A1:J50") 
# Here A1:J50 is the area over which cart is
r.CopyPicture()
Run Code Online (Sandbox Code Playgroud)

这是我被困的地方.我现在需要将所选范围复制到文件中.对文档的任何帮助或指示可以帮助我很多.

我已根据以下VBA脚本对上述代码进行了建模:

Sub Export_Range_Images()
    ' =========================================
    ' Code to save selected Excel Range as Image
    ' =========================================
    Dim oRange As Range
    Dim oCht As Chart
    Dim oImg As Picture

    Set oRange = Range("A1:B2")
    Set oCht = Charts.Add
    oRange.CopyPicture xlScreen, xlPicture
    oCht.Paste
    oCht.Export FileName:="C:\temp\SavedRange.jpg", Filtername:="JPG"
End Sub
Run Code Online (Sandbox Code Playgroud)

代码片段来自:http://vbadud.blogspot.com/2010/06/how-to-save-excel-range-as-image-using.html

python windows excel winapi win32com

2
推荐指数
3
解决办法
1万
查看次数

标签 统计

python ×3

excel ×1

ip-address ×1

urllib2 ×1

win32com ×1

winapi ×1

windows ×1